Natural Resources (MNR) Master’s program is designed for current and potential practitioners who wish to improve their educational credentials for a career in natural resources and environmental sustainability which also helps set the career path as practitioners in natural resource, cultural, and sustainability .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University's Online Master of Natural Resources (MNR) program is a 30-hour virtual degree program designed to accommodate maximum flexibility in busy schedules and prepare students for careers in environmental sustainability. The interdisciplinary program provides the logical and critical thinking skills required for the creation of lifelong learning and careers.
The goal of the MNR graduate program at University of Idaho's is to incorporate and scale various ecological, planning, policy and social viewpoints and tools and technologies into a system view of natural resources. This degree program can be completed either entirely online or by integrating on-line and on-campus courses.
